What do we learn about prayer from Jesus example?
What do we learn about prayer from Jesus’ example? From Jesus’ example we learn that prayer must precede any work we do for God’s Kingdom, because through prayer we place ourselves and our work in his hands. We learn to take time to pray in silence and solitude, no matter how busy we are.

What are the 4 types of prayer?
The tradition of the Catholic Church highlights four basic elements of Christian prayer: (1) Prayer of Adoration/Blessing, (2) Prayer of Contrition/Repentance, (3) Prayer of Thanksgiving/Gratitude, and (4) Prayer of Supplication/Petition/Intercession.

Why do we need to pray if God knows everything?
When we take the time to pray, we acknowledge our dependence upon the Lord and his grace and mercy. … God doesn’t need your prayers because He knows exactly what you need before you even ask, but we need Him in our lives so desperately. Our prayers are a proactive act of faith on our part.
